Power off your system while mowing.
To avoid lawn clippings from entering your outside A/C equipment, turn your thermostat to “off” while you are landscaping. You should also keep the outdoor equipment clear from any obstructions so it has enough room to perform properly.
Keep air supply vents open and free from obstruction.
To ensure proper airflow, be sure your return air grills are open and have plenty of space around them.
Get routine pest control maintenance.
Bugs can make their way into the electrical components within your outdoor air conditioning equipment. These bugs could potentially cause the equipment to malfunction so spreading an environmentally safe pesticide around the base of your outdoor system can help stop insect infestation issues.
